Carp fish can be found in the wild in freshwater. It is a group of fish native to Europe and Asia. There are many kinds of this species are introduced around the world.
The carp we commonly refer to when using that name are the common carp, the grass carp, the bighead carp, the silver carp and the Crucian carp. Certainly there are other fish is this very large family. You may recognize koi as carp, and there are many other members of this group of fish. A full list of them would number in three digits.

Common types of fish found in China include carp (such as grass carp, silver carp, and common carp), tilapia, catfish, trout, and eel. China has a rich variety of freshwater and saltwater fish species due to its diverse geographical and climatic conditions.
